Google Document AI

Google Document AI uses a pay-per-use pricing model with no upfront fees. Enterprise Document OCR costs $1.50 per 1,000 pages for the first 5 million pages monthly, dropping to $0.60 per 1,000 pages above that volume. Custom extractors and Form Parser cost $30 per 1,000 pages at lower volumes, with discounts to $20 per 1,000 pages for higher volumes. Layout Parser is consistently $10 per 1,000 pages. Organizations with high volumes benefit from significant volume discounts.

Pay-per-use model starting at $1.50 per 1,000 pages for OCR processing

Volume discounts available for processing above 5 million pages monthly

No failed request charges for 4xx or 5xx response codes

Google Document AI
Cloud-based document extraction and OCR platform

Google Document AI is a cloud-based document processing solution that converts unstructured content into structured data. The platform offers Enterprise Document OCR, custom extractors, form parsers, and layout analyzers that handle PDFs, images, and Microsoft Office documents. Surfaces follows a pay-per-use model starting at $1.50 per 1,000 pages for OCR, with volume discounts for high-throughput processing. Google Document AI integrates natively with Cloud Vision, Natural Language API, BigQuery, and Vertex AI, making it particularly appealing for organizations already invested in the Google Cloud ecosystem seeking scalable document digitization.
